NPFL: Niger Tornadoes to miss three key players ahead of Ikorodu City clash

By Wale Mustapha

Niger Tornadoes will be without three key players when they face high-flying Ikorodu City in their Nigeria Premier Football League (NPFL) Matchday 33 fixture.

Victor Okoro and Ifeanyi Okechukwu have been ruled out due to injuries, while Papa Daniel will miss the match through illness, the club confirmed.

Head coach Majin Mohammed is expected to turn to his bench for suitable replacements.

The Tornadoes were held to a goalless draw by Ikorodu City in the first-leg encounter earlier in the season.

Their opponents come into the match in red-hot form, having thrashed Katsina United 6-0 in a rescheduled Matchday 31 fixture.

Niger Tornadoes sit 11th on the NPFL table with 43 points, while Ikorodu City are in fourth place on 49 points as the season heads into its final stretch.
